`meta::Cache::reset` can panic

fuchsnj opened this issue · 0 comments

What version of regex are you using?

Latest / 0.4.4

Describe the bug at a high level.

Calling .reset(..) on a meta::Cache can panic if called on a different regex than it was created with (which is the whole point of reset).

What are the steps to reproduce the behavior?

use regex_automata::meta::Regex;

fn main() {
    let re1 = Regex::new("").unwrap();
    let re2 = Regex::new("\\b").unwrap();
    re1.create_cache().reset(&re2);
}

What is the actual behavior?

thread 'main' panicked at /playground/.cargo/registry/src/index.crates.io-6f17d22bba15001f/regex-automata-0.4.3/src/meta/wrappers.rs:507:29:
called `Option::unwrap()` on a `None` value

What is the expected behavior?

It should not panic, and allow using that cache on the new regex.

Additional info

One example of a location this panics is: https://github.com/rust-lang/regex/blob/master/regex-automata/src/meta/wrappers.rs#L799
although it looks like other reset implementations have similar issues.
